
German playmaker Mesut Ozil was 'never the same' at Arsenal after Santi Cazorla left the club.
That is the opinion of Ozil's agent, who was speaking about his client's eventual decline at the Emirates Stadium club.
Ozil did win three FA Cup trophies, scored 44 goals, and managed 77 assists during an eight-year stint with the Gunners.
"He had Santi for a while and he loved him," Ozil's agent Erkut Sogut told AFTV.
"I think probably one of his most favourite players. Mesut is a smart, intelligent player, he reads the game and he is always looking. He loves to play with intelligent players.
"If you're a No.10 the one in front of you and the one behind you, a good striker and good No.6 who cleans it up and sees you and plays you the ball so you can give the final pass.
"Santi is very smart, very intelligent and has great technique and that suited Mesut a lot to have him behind him.
"When Santi left you could see it wasn't the same any more, right away it changed."
